Class 3 Mobility Scooters are able to reach speeds of up to 8mph and are specifically designed to be used on roads. They are noticeably bigger than their pavement-only counterparts. They usually come with rearview mirrors, suspension and bigger tyres to cope with curbs. They can also be equipped with indicators, lights and a horn to assist your parent remain safe on the road.

There is no need for a driver's license for class 3 scooters however, it is recommended that you are familiar with the highway code. It is also necessary to perform an annual MOT in order to maintain the safety of the vehicle.

Battery Life

When purchasing a quick mobility scooter, it's important to look at the battery's lifespan. Depending on how much you use the scooter and the type of terrain, the battery can last from 18 months to three years if it is properly cared for. If you use the scooter often and on long journeys, the battery may require replacement sooner.

The type of battery in the scooter is one of the most crucial factors in the length of battery life. The majority of mobility scooters are equipped with lead-acid batteries, which are either gel or absorbent glass mat (AGM) varieties. Gel batteries tend to keep their charge for longer and can last longer cycles than AGM versions, which makes them a good choice for heavy or frequent users. Lithium-ion batteries are becoming the preferred option for mobility scooters. They offer a higher efficiency, and can be recharged in less time.

Whatever battery you are using on your scooter it is essential to fully charge the batteries overnight for eight hours. This ensures that the batteries are at their maximum capacity and allows them to remain free of physical damage to their internal plates. The plates of the batteries can sulfate if they are left uncharged for a long time. This causes the battery's capacity and range to decrease over time.

It is essential to keep your scooter clean and free of any debris. This will enable the motor and battery to function efficiently. It is recommended to clean the battery and other components with a clean cloth regularly. It is crucial to remember that dirt and dust can reduce the life of a battery, especially when the scooter is used on rough terrains.

Replace your mobility scooter's battery when it is showing signs of reduced performance, like a reduced range or an inability to charge. Make sure you purchase replacement batteries that are compatible with the specifications suggested by the manufacturer. This will ensure that the new battery is compatible with your scooter and is able to be installed without any problems.
